Iswarbaha Population - Hugli, West Bengal

Iswarbaha is a medium size village located in Chinsurah - Magra Block of Hugli district, West Bengal with total 415 families residing. The Iswarbaha village has population of 1808 of which 913 are males while 895 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Iswarbaha village population of children with age 0-6 is 196 which makes up 10.84 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Iswarbaha village is 980 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Iswarbaha as per census is 849, lower than West Bengal average of 956.

Iswarbaha village has higher liter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Iswarbaha village was 85.17 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Iswarbaha Male literacy stands at 88.23 % while female literacy rate was 82.11 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 4.31 % of total population in Iswarbaha village. The village Iswarbaha curr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Iswarbaha village out of total population, 606 were engaged in work activities. 87.46 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 12.54 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 606 workers engaged in Main Work, 9 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 9 were Agricultural labourer.
